    About Discovery Insure
  • Discovery Insure is committed to creating a nation of great drivers and building better businesses through our innovative Sharedvalue Insurance model. Discovery Insure is South Africa's fastest growing shortterm insurance company with comprehensive products that provide protection against current and emerging risks facing clients in the motor, home and business insurance sectors. Vitality Drive, an internationallyrecognised and awardwinning programme, is a key differentiator in the market that incentivises and rewards clients for driving well. The Vitality Drive programme has been scaled to local and international markets which now include Europe and the Middle East.

The company employs over 1 000 people who are committed to putting our customers and financial advisers first by providing unique and innovative solutions and cover.


Key Purpose

  • To
-
investigate and validate buildings claims to determine validity based on the Discovery Insure contract. To correctly quantify and validate losses and serve as a mediator between clients and/or brokers. Provide feedback and support to claims consultants and foster good relationships between brokers and clients.
Areas of responsibility may include but not limited to
-
Buildings claims investigation and validation, including settlement, rejection, and repair within service level agreement.

  • Turnaround time and predetermined mandates.
  • Loss adjustment by correctly quantifying losses and/or verifying claimed amounts. Mediation between Insure client and/or broker.
  • Reporting on all assessed claims and making recommendations.
  • Analyse client behaviour to determine legitimacy of claims.
  • Investigate and report on fraudulent claims.
  • Perform administrative tasks and meet deadlines.
  • Make recommendations to prevent fraud.
  • Analyse, collecting, evaluating, and handling of evidence.
  • Claims forum presenting of claims.

Education and Experience

  • Matric (Essential)
  • 3 years' minimum short term insurance claims experience (Essential)
  • 3 years' shortterm insurance buildings claim
    validations and investigations experience (Essential)
  • Interviewing techniques (Essential)
  • Tertiary qualification relating to investigations and interviewing e.g., Certified Fraud Examiner (Advantageous)
  • Hold a valid driver licence (Essential)
  • Willing to travel (Essential)
